Method
Starter/Base
- 1
Prepare aromatics
Heat a large skillet over medium heat. Add 2 tbs extra-virgin olive oil. When shimmering, add minced garlic and diced onion. Sauté 2–3 minutes until fragrant and translucent, stirring frequently to prevent burning.

Proteins & Vegetables
- 3
Brown the chicken
Increase heat to medium-high. Push vegetables to the edges and add the chicken pieces in a single layer. Let cook undisturbed 2–3 minutes to brown, then stir and cook another 2 minutes until mostly cooked through. If needed, work in batches to avoid overcrowding.

Liquids & Seasoning
- 5
Deglaze and build sauce
Pour in 1 cup dry white wine or chicken broth to deglaze the pan, scraping brown bits from the bottom with a wooden spoon. Allow the liquid to reduce by about half, 3–4 minutes.
- 6
Add broth and thicken
Stir in 2 cups low-sodium chicken broth. In a small bowl, whisk together 1 cup heavy cream, 2 tsp flour, and 1 tbs Dijon mustard until smooth; add the mixture to the skillet. Stir to combine and bring just to a gentle simmer so sauce begins to thicken, about 4–5 minutes.
- 7
Season and finish sauce
Add 1 tsp dried thyme, 1 tsp salt, 1/2 tsp black pepper, 1 tsp lemon zest, and 1 tsp lemon juice. Taste and adjust seasoning as desired. Reduce heat to low and simmer another 2 minutes to meld flavors.

Garnish and serve
Sprinkle chopped parsley and 1/4 cup grated Parmesan over the dish. Serve immediately over rice, pasta, or crusty bread if desired.
